Barbara,
I always appreciate suggestions on quilting--it's the last thing and so often overlooked. Thank you.
The Line Tamer ruler looked awesome. Can I use it with my domestic machine? I have a Bernini 770qe+.
Thanks.
Lynne
- IP
Comment
-
Yes. The ruler foot is required for free motion quilting and is available for your 770. I also have a 765, same basic machine. The foot fits in the channel of the Line Tamer ruler, holding it straight as you quilt. I use it for stitch in the ditch and all straight line quilting. Search on my blog for Ruler Work, I have more than a few posts about this.
